Council and church in land deal

LARNE Borough Council has agreed to sell just over half-an-acre of ground to St Cedma’s Parish Church for £35,000.

The fee, set by the District Valuer, is said to reflect reduced market prices and lower than that first quoted to the parish in 2008 for the site next to the war memorial.

The council has also agreed to grant St Cedma’s right-of-way assess to the site.
